billinder33 wrote: Wed Mar 19, 2025 1:48 pm Serum is the OG easy-to-configure, in-your-face, wub-wub FM synth. IMO Serum 2 hasn't changed what made Serum 1 so popular, it just extended the functionality with the kind of features people expect from a flagship synth in 2025.
To me, Serum 1 was firmly a wavetable synth. It offered FM, RM, filters etc. but all of that felt secondary to the wavetable paradigm.

Right now I'm thinking of Serum 2 as a monster synth that happens to have wavetables as a feature. You can stick with sines on all of the oscillators, and still have so many options for (audio-rate) modulation and distortion, plus the improved filters, to take it really far. The spectral osc with its warp features is pretty fantastic too, but I've barely explored it so far (and granular and multisample even less, sample not at all yet).

If Serum 1 was a department store, Serum 2 is an entire mall.

Stan Navi wrote: Wed Mar 19, 2025 1:03 pm I wish Serum 2 would have Multisample Editor. I don't want to search and use SFZ converter. In many synths I can just drag and drop multiple samples and set it inside editor.
Yeah, that's a real bummer. I was expecting I could just drag a bunch of samples in the oscillator pane and then select 'multisample' for it to distribute the samples automatically. Like Logic's sampler or Alchemy allows you to do. Alchemy handles this really well when dragging a bunch of samples (or any soundsource) onto an oscillator.

There is also no way to redistribute or edit any of the multisample settings of existing sets.
